VANDERGRIFF LOOSES SMOKEFEST IN E-TOWN


     Old Bridge, NJ. (June 19, 2006)- Elimination's for the K & N Filters 
Supernationals at Old Bridge Township Raceway Park saw very hot and humid 
conditions, something they hadn't experienced all weekend in Englishtown.. The UPS 
Top Fuel team thought they had it all under control. They were set for their 
first round meeting with Hillary Will. The car launched hard as Bob Vandergriff 
Jr. hit the throttle, but shortly afterward the car went into tire-smoke, 
followed by Will's car striking the tires as well. Both drivers were on and off the 
throttle until Will crossed the stripe first, defeating Vandergriff's run of 
5.935 with a 5.741 to claim the first round win.
     "The car launched right," explained car chief Scott French. "We had 
parts failure in the clutch. It shook the tires hard and then went into tire 
smoke. Vandergriff did all he could but the car didn't react the way it should 
have. We'll get it fixed and be ready to run hard next week in St. Louis."
     Vandergriff leaves Englishtown in the 12th position in the POWERade 
points standings.
